Yea My switch didn't work either, I then slit the rubber hose from the door to the car, and found 2 broken wires. I repaired them and now everything works. The weird thing is, that the one wire, when it was disconnected, my switch wouldn't work the driver or passenger windows. Then fixed it worked both.
